
解析Localstorage文件的打开方式与技巧
简介:
Localstorage是HTML5标准中提供的一种浏览器本地存储机制,它允许网页在用户的浏览器端存储数据,并且该数据不受浏览器关闭的影响。本文将介绍Localstorage文件的打开方式与相关技巧,并提供具体的代码示例。
一、Localstorage文件的打开方式
下面是一个示例代码,演示如何向Localstorage中写入数据并读取出来:
// 向Localstorage中写入数据
localStorage.setItem("name", "John");
localStorage.setItem("age", "25");
// 从Localstorage中读取数据
var name = localStorage.getItem("name");
var age = localStorage.getItem("age");
console.log("Name: " + name); // 输出:Name: John
console.log("Age: " + age); // 输出:Age: 25以下是一个示例代码,展示了如何将对象存储到Localstorage并读取出来:
// 定义一个对象
var user = {
name: "John",
age: 25
};
// 将对象转换为字符串并存储到Localstorage
localStorage.setItem("user", JSON.stringify(user));
// 从Localstorage中读取并转换为原始对象
var storedUser = JSON.parse(localStorage.getItem("user"));
console.log(storedUser.name); // 输出:John
console.log(storedUser.age); // 输出:25二、Localstorage文件的技巧
检查浏览器是否支持Localstorage:
在使用Localstorage之前,可以通过判断浏览器是否支持Localstorage来避免出错。可以使用以下代码进行检测:
if (typeof(Storage) !== "undefined") {
// 浏览器支持Localstorage
} else {
// 浏览器不支持Localstorage
}检查Localstorage中是否存在某个键值:
在读取Localstorage中的数据之前,可以先检查该键值是否存在,以避免出现空指针错误。可以使用以下代码进行检测:
if (localStorage.getItem("name") !== null) {
// Localstorage中存在该键值
} else {
// Localstorage中不存在该键值
}localStorage.clear();
结论:
本文介绍了Localstorage文件的打开方式与相关技巧,并提供了具体的代码示例。通过localStorage对象和JSON对象的使用,我们可以轻松地操作Localstorage中的数据。同时,合理地运用技巧可以增强程序的健壮性和用户体验。希望本文对您理解和使用Localstorage提供了帮助。
以上就是本文介绍解析localstorage文件的打开方式和技巧的详细内容,更多请关注php中文网其它相关文章!
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号